Auditor's Responsibilities for the Audit of the Consolidated Financial Results
Our objectives are to obtain reasonable assurance about whether the Consolidated Financial Results as a whole is free from material misstatement, whether due to fraud or error, and to issue an auditor's report that includes our opinion. Reasonable assurance is a high level of assurance but is not a guarantee that an audit conducted in accordance with SAs will always detect a material misstatement when it exists. Misstatements can arise from fraud or error and are considered material if, individually or in the aggregate, they could reasonably be expected to influence the economic decisions of users taken on the basis of this Consolidated Financial Results.
As part of an audit in accordance with SAs, we exercise professional judgment and maintain professional skepticism throughout the audit. We also:
- * identify and assess the risks of material misstatement of the Consolidated Financial Results, whether due to fraud or error, design and perform audit procedures responsive to those risks, and obtain audit evidence that is sufficient and appropriate to provide a basis for our opinion. The risk of not detecting a material misstatement resulting from fraud is higher than for one resulting from error, as fraud may involve collusion, forgery, intentional omissions, misrepresentations, or the override of internal control.
- * obtain an understanding of internal financial controls with reference to consolidated financial statements in order to design audit procedures that are appropriate in the circumstances, but not for the purpose of expressing an opinion on the effectiveness of such controls.
- * evaluate the appropriateness of accounting policies used and the reasonableness of accounting estimates and related disclosures made by management.
- * conclude on the appropriateness of management's use of the going concern basis of accounting and, based on the audit evidence obtained, whether a material uncertainty exists related to events or conditions that may cast significant doubt on the ability of the Group to continue as a going concern. If we conclude that a material uncertainty exis are required to draw
attention in our. auditor's report to the related disclosures in the Consolidated Financial Results or, if such disclosures are inadequate, to modify our opinion. Our conclusions are based on the audit evidence obtained up to the date of our auditor's report. However, future events or conditions may cause the Group to cease to continue as a going concern.
- * evaluate the overall presentation, structure and content of the Statement, including the disclosures, and whether the Statement represents the underlying transactions and events in a manner that achieves fair presentation.
- * obtain sufficient appropriate audit evidence regarding the Consolidated Financial Information of the entities within the Group to express an opinion on the Consolidated Financial Results. We are responsible for the direction, supervision and performance of the audit of financial information of such entities included in the Consolidated Financial Results of which we are the independent auditors. For the other entities included in the Consolidated Financial Results, which have been audited by the other auditors, such other auditors remain responsible for the direction, supervision and performance of the audits carried out by them. We remain solely responsible for our audit opinion.

2 The Company is engaged solely in trading activity segment and all activities of the Company revolve around this business. As such there are no other reportable segment as defined by the Indian Accounting Standard - 108 on "Operating Segment" issued by the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India.
- 3 Since the closure of the financial year, there is several disruption caused by the local lock downs announced by various State Governments consequent to Covid-19 second wave crisis.From the experience of the previous lock down,the Company has been adequately geared up to ensure the lock downs do not severely affect the operations that are possible during this period as well as past lock down period, The Company expects the carrying amount of assets to be fully realisable.
- 4 The Company has elected to exercise non-reversible option to pay tax u/s 115 BAA of the Income-tax Act, 1961 from this year i.e from A.¥.2021-22 and remeasured its deferred tax balances on the basis of rate prescribed in the said section, Further, the brought forward Mat credit Entitlement being part of Deferred Tax Asset has been written off and charged to the Statement of Profit & Loss.
- 5 A Composite Scheme of Arrangement between the Company and RMIL Metal industries (P) Ltd (RMIPL) (resulting company/transferor company) and Rashtriya Metal industries Ltd (RMIL) (transferee company/subsidiary of the Company) has been approved on 04th November, 2020 by the Board of Directors of the respective companies for demerger of metal business of the Company and vesting in RMIPL and subsequently for amalgamation of RMIPL with RMIL with effect from 1st October, 2020 being the Appointed Date. The Scheme will be effective upon receipt of such approvals as may be statutorily required including that of the Mumbai Bench of the National Company Law Tribunal. Pending the regulatory approvals, no effect of the proposed demerger has been considered in this statement.
